# Who to Contact: Checkout Load Testing

Welcome aboard! Load tests against the Larkspur checkout flow go through the Perf Guild — don't just point traffic at staging, it shares a database with the fraud team's sandbox and they will notice. Book a window in the LoadLedger calendar first, then file a short test plan (template on this wiki). Questions about capacity limits or test windows should go straight to the guild inbox.

billing contact of tahaf-kafop = istwyn_fraox@norvaworks.corp

The Corvane hardware security module ships from Thistlegate Systems in a tamper-sealed transit case. Two-person receipt required; the office manager countersigns. Inspect seals before accepting. Case stays unopened until the security officer arrives — no exceptions. Courier waits during inspection; refused deliveries return same day. Log serial, seal numbers, and arrival time in the transport register. Do not photograph the unit. The confidential hand-over instruction for the courier is recorded on the line below.

handover note for yagef-bagep: the drudor pelius courier leaves the kasdor zorvan norir ledger at gate 8016 under passcode 755406

## Deployment

Quick note for whoever inherits Pondworks: the connection pooler (we use Brookline, our in-house fork) sits between the API tier and the Tanagra cluster. Don't be tempted to crank pool size — Tanagra caps backends at 200 and the reaper gets cranky. Deploys drain connections gracefully if you give them 30 seconds; kill -9 and you'll leak slots. Restart the pooler last, always. The values we ship to production are these.

service settings:
[casax]
port = 6379
team = rusir
host = casax.zemvarhq.corp
region = outer-4
access_code = ac_9808ce
timeout_ms = 1500

CI note for fresh contractors: the thumbnail job in Pixelforge's resizer CLI fails if the batch manifest lists zero-byte images — the worker exits 3 with no message. Run the manifest linter locally before pushing. If the job hangs past 10 minutes, kill it; the retry queue drains itself. When filing a failure report, include the build token shown below.

pipeline stamp: htk9_ce63042d9